Vertical Jump Characteristics and Lower Limbs Muscular Contribution in Chilean Volleyball Players during the Counter Movement Jump (cmj)

The purpose of this study was to determine and to compare characteristics of the lower limb extension musculature in Chilean indoor and beach volleyball players and the muscular contribution during the CMJ. The sample was composed by 13 subjects belonging to the Chilean elite beach and indoor volleyball. The subjects performed 3 CMJ jumps for average determination of the height of the jump, eccentric force development rate (TDFE), concentric force development rate (TDFC), power and lower limbs muscular contribution, evaluated using force platform and wireless electromyography (EMG). The results demonstrated a significant relationship between the height of the jump-TDFC and power-TDFC and Medial vasti muscle has obtained the most significant contribution during the CMJ in volleyball players.
